Web6 apr. 2024 · These Pug hybrids mentioned in this article are likely the result of inadvertent breeding. It’s worth remembering with cross breeds that there is no guarantee which traits a dog will inherit from each parent. So you could be disappointed if you find a Pugapoo hoping that it’ll have a hypoallergenic coat like the Poodle parent.

Pugs shed a lot, especially pugs with double coats. A double coat is a soft inner layer and a short outer layer of fur. A double coat means double the shedding.
